• Tropic of Cancer, Paris: Obelisk Press, 1934. • Black Spring, Paris: Obelisk Press, 1936. • Tropic of Capricorn, Paris: Obelisk Press, 1939. • The Cosmological Eye, Norfolk, CT: New Directions, 1939.
